Transaction 8f6176149c6cbd9e86cbf32f29582c990efae1a828ab03fecc11f4d658d99a5b

1 Input
2 Outputs
  • 8f6176149c6cbd9e86cbf32f29582c990efae1a828ab03fecc11f4d658d99a5b:0
  • value  357510
    address  1HEEwEtFPVvQowhkq3yM6bkw3xriT29Y7R
  • 8f6176149c6cbd9e86cbf32f29582c990efae1a828ab03fecc11f4d658d99a5b:1
  • value  58658
    address  bc1qvukykgnjujnqgcpushsvyh4p4gm6lxnjk050j5